Abstract
The study is carried out to clear the phenomenon of the flow of self-shiphonage, which is the main cause of the water seal loss in the trap. The drainage system for the experiments are attached an S trap to each sanitary fixture. The experiments were performed by changing some factors which seem to have influences on the characteristics of the drainage flow, and carried out for the case of washing in filled water and washing with running water. The influences fo these factors are qualitatively analyzed, and the phenomenon of the flow just before the finish of discharge was analyzed by the experiments which an S trap is attached to the sanitary fixture. This report is suggested four actual models of the discharge flow, as follows ; (1) the case of generating the initial water head in the inlet of the trap. (model 1) (2) the case of the inflow equal to discharge. (model 2) (3) the case of generating the initial water head by return water from the weir of the trap. (mode 13) (4) the case of the plug flow is occured just before the finish of discharge. (model 4) Depending on assuming those models, the authors consider that a theoretically analysis will be able to be produced in future.
